Kowa LM25HC-SW 1" 25mm SWIR C-Mount Lens: Unleashing Precision in Machine Vision

The Kowa LM25HC-SW 1" 25mm SWIR C-Mount Lens is a highly specialized optical component designed for demanding industrial and commercial applications. Engineered to perform optimally in the Short-Wave Infrared (SWIR) range from 800nm to 1900nm, this lens offers high transmission, making it an ideal choice for various machine vision applications. With a manual aperture control ranging from F1.4 to F16, users can easily adjust the lens to achieve optimal image quality and resolution. The Kowa LM25HC-SW is particularly suited for applications like solar cell inspection, waste sorting, and biological research, where precise imaging is critical.

This lens features a focal length of 25mm and a focus range from 0.45m to infinity, allowing for versatile use in different scenarios. Its robust design ensures performance stability within a temperature range of -10°C to +50°C, catering to diverse operational environments. With a resolution of 120 lp/mm at the center and 80 lp/mm at the margins, the lens guarantees exceptional clarity, ensuring that every detail is captured for analysis and quality assurance. Features:

  • Focal Length: 25mm
  • Aperture (F-stop): 1.4 - 16 (manual control)
  • Wavelength Range: SWIR (1000nm - 2000nm)
  • Resolution: 120 lp/mm (center), 80 lp/mm (margins)
  • Temperature Range: -10°C to +50°C
  • Focus Range: 0.45m to infinity
  • Size: Ø43 x 43 mm
  • Weight: 125g
  • Mount: C-mount
  • TV Distortion: -1%
